Understanding Family Law in Australia

Here are some key areas of focus consist of:

  • Divorce and Separation:

Australia has a “no-fault” divorce system, suggesting that there is no need to deliver resistance to marital betrayal to file for divorce. However, before a divorce is decided, sure supplies must be attained, like the obligatory time off.

  • Child Custody and Support:

One of the main areas of family law is to select how children will be high and be concerned after a divorce. When decisive choices about care and support, the best goalmouths of the child are the first worry. This entails taking into account the child’s choices, each parent’s relation to them, and paternal ability.

  • Property Settlement:

The division of finances and assets following the end of a marriage or de facto relationship requires careful negotiations or involvement in courts. A just and equitable division of property is arrived at by taking into account different variables, such as cash contributions, future needs, and other gifts to the cooperation.

  • Spousal Maintenance:

In cases when a spouse experiences economic challenges after divorcing, spousal support could be granted to offer continuing assistance. The amount and length of payments for maintenance are chosen after taking into account each party’s age, health, and earning potential.
